#ifndef __AUDIO_TYPES_H__
#define __AUDIO_TYPES_H__

#include "signal_types.h"

#define AUDIO_INFO_DISPLAY_NAME_SIZE_IN_CHARS 20
#define MAX_HW_AUDIO_INFO_DISPLAY_NAME_SIZE_IN_CHARS 18
#define MULTI_CHANNEL_SPLIT_NO_ASSO_INFO 0xFFFFFFFF


struct audio_crtc_info {
        uint32_t h_total;
        uint32_t h_active;
        uint32_t v_active;
        uint32_t pixel_repetition;
        uint32_t requested_pixel_clock; /* in KHz */
        uint32_t calculated_pixel_clock; /* in KHz */
        uint32_t refresh_rate;
        enum dc_color_depth color_depth;
        bool interlaced;
};
struct azalia_clock_info {
        uint32_t pixel_clock_in_10khz;
        uint32_t audio_dto_phase;
        uint32_t audio_dto_module;
        uint32_t audio_dto_wall_clock_ratio;
};

enum audio_dto_source {
        DTO_SOURCE_UNKNOWN = 0,
        DTO_SOURCE_ID0,
        DTO_SOURCE_ID1,
        DTO_SOURCE_ID2,
        DTO_SOURCE_ID3,
        DTO_SOURCE_ID4,
        DTO_SOURCE_ID5
};

/* PLL information required for AZALIA DTO calculation */

struct audio_pll_info {
        uint32_t dp_dto_source_clock_in_khz;
        uint32_t feed_back_divider;
        enum audio_dto_source dto_source;
        bool ss_enabled;
        uint32_t ss_percentage;
        uint32_t ss_percentage_divider;
};

struct audio_channel_associate_info {
        union {
                struct {
                        uint32_t ALL_CHANNEL_FL:4;
                        uint32_t ALL_CHANNEL_FR:4;
                        uint32_t ALL_CHANNEL_FC:4;
                        uint32_t ALL_CHANNEL_Sub:4;
                        uint32_t ALL_CHANNEL_SL:4;
                        uint32_t ALL_CHANNEL_SR:4;
                        uint32_t ALL_CHANNEL_BL:4;
                        uint32_t ALL_CHANNEL_BR:4;
                } bits;
                uint32_t u32all;
        };
};

struct audio_output {
        /* Front DIG id. */
        enum engine_id engine_id;
        /* encoder output signal */
        enum signal_type signal;
        /* video timing */
        struct audio_crtc_info crtc_info;
        /* PLL for audio */
        struct audio_pll_info pll_info;
};

enum audio_payload {
        CHANNEL_SPLIT_MAPPINGCHANG = 0x9,
};

#endif /* __AUDIO_TYPES_H__ */
